The X500, X500T, X160 and X150 are direct descendants of models dating back to 1953 and 1954. Guild's reputation was originally built on its jazz guitar roots and roster--including New York City session players like Johnny Smith, Carl Kress, and George Barnes. All Guild® guitars are accompanied by a deluxe archtop case. These instruments recall the golden age of jazz with their classy styling and vintage appointments. The bound body is comprised of laminated Curly Maple measuring 16" wide and 3" deep. The neck is Mahogany, with a Rosewood fretboard, traditional block inlays, and a 24-3/4" scale. Powered by our custom-designed Guild chrome-plated humbucking pickup (the X150 has one; X150D has two), both Savoy models are equipped with chrome Grover tuners and Guild's distinctive harp tailpiece.
